#be153d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be153d is composed of 74.5% red, 8.2%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.9% magenta, 67.9%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 345.8 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 41.4%. #be153d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a7a with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#be153d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be153d has RGB values of R:190, G:21,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.68,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12457277.

Shades and Tints of #be153d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0104 is the darkest color, while #fffbfc is the lightest one.
